Google Pixel July Phone Update Now Available

The July Android security patch was released this morning for Google’s Pixel line of devices and phones. This update follows a major Pixel feature drop in June and is expected to be fairly minor. In fact, it should mostly be a bug fix to address any issues left over from last month’s major quarterly build.

As for the devices that will get the update in July, it’s the same list we had last month , which means the Pixel 5a, Pixel 6 and 6 Pro, Pixel 6a, Pixel 7 and 7 Pro, Pixel 7a, Pixel 8 and 8 Pro, Pixel 8a, Pixel Fold, and Pixel Tablet. The Pixel 5a is closer to the end of its lifespan, though, with the final update scheduled for August 2024.

When it comes to fixes and changes, we have three notes from Verizon and Google:

  • Provides the latest Android security patches for your device
  • Provides overall camera stability improvements
  • Provides overall system stability improvements
  • Fixed an issue where back gesture navigation did not work in some conditions

Google (and its carrier partners like Verizon, T-Mobile, and AT&T) will begin pushing these updates over the air soon (Settings > System > System Update), but if you don’t want to wait for Google and would rather update manually, you can find each factory image or OTA file soon at the links below.
